If 1 yard of fabric cost $5 how much would 2 1/4 yard of fabric cost?

Answer:

11.25

Step-by-step explanation:

2 yards of fabric would be $10 because it's $5 per yard so 5x2=10. Then you divide 5/4 which would give you 1.25 so then you add 10+1.25 which gives you 11.25.
